View Top Employees for Emerge Massachusetts
img Website emergema.org
img Industry Political Organization
img Location Massachusetts, United States
img Employees 8
img Founded 2008
img Website emergema.org
img Industry Political Organization
img Location Massachusetts, United States
img Employees 8
img Founded 2008
img LinkedIn linkedin.com/company/emerge-massachusetts

Top Emerge Massachusetts Employees